It depends what you mean by saying "LLM with internship." - internship as part of the program or internship options upon graduation.

McGeorge has a unique program of the first kind which allows you to choose from 3 options:

1. Study one semester in Salzburg, then go to their Sacramento campus for 6 weeks of pre-internship training/classes and then do a 10-12 weeks internship with a law firm anywhere in the world (US, Asia, Europe, Latin America).

2, Start your studies in Sacramento and continue with the internship as explained above.

3. Or just study one semester in Salzburg, one semester in Sacramento; or two semesters in Sacramento (no internship).

In their LLM program the internship is 100% guaranteed. It's just part of the program.

Pittsburgh offers an internship after you graduate but I am not sure whether they will just help you with the placement (general advice as all schools do) or will find you an internship for sure. Besides, I assume their options are limited to the USA only. Anyways, you have to ask the school for more information.
